Output ecd71ea616c210431e1f40222ac093bc788caf4ab47e072854ff325858e2752f:12

value
2359707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94077d4877dbe741bde177a8fd662edd15376f6e OP_EQUAL
address
3FBiuJiwt8sgGbG5Ck2e7UzpbSwS4ibcDQ
transaction
ecd71ea616c210431e1f40222ac093bc788caf4ab47e072854ff325858e2752f
spent
true